MUK Project:
health survey project of Makerere University School of Public Health in
collaboration with the US Centers for Disease Control and Prevention (CDC) and
the Aids Control Program of Ministry of Health. The project plans to conduct a
national household-based survey to “Pilot the Size Estimation of Key
Populations at Higher Risk for HIV Infection in Uganda”.
